Home
last modified time | relevance | path

Searched refs:vrsa (Results 1 – 3 of 3) sorted by relevance

/openssl/providers/implementations/kem/
H A Drsa_kem.c121 static int rsakem_init(void *vprsactx, void *vrsa, in rsakem_init() argument
128 if (prsactx == NULL || vrsa == NULL) in rsakem_init()
131 if (!ossl_rsa_key_op_get_protect(vrsa, operation, &protect)) in rsakem_init()
133 if (!RSA_up_ref(vrsa)) in rsakem_init()
136 prsactx->rsa = vrsa; in rsakem_init()
150 static int rsakem_encapsulate_init(void *vprsactx, void *vrsa, in rsakem_encapsulate_init() argument
153 return rsakem_init(vprsactx, vrsa, params, EVP_PKEY_OP_ENCAPSULATE, in rsakem_encapsulate_init()
157 static int rsakem_decapsulate_init(void *vprsactx, void *vrsa, in rsakem_decapsulate_init() argument
160 return rsakem_init(vprsactx, vrsa, params, EVP_PKEY_OP_DECAPSULATE, in rsakem_decapsulate_init()
/openssl/providers/implementations/signature/
H A Drsa_sig.c503 rsa_signverify_init(PROV_RSA_CTX *prsactx, void *vrsa, in rsa_signverify_init() argument
513 if (vrsa == NULL && prsactx->rsa == NULL) { in rsa_signverify_init()
518 if (vrsa != NULL) { in rsa_signverify_init()
519 if (!RSA_up_ref(vrsa)) in rsa_signverify_init()
522 prsactx->rsa = vrsa; in rsa_signverify_init()
914 static int rsa_verify_recover_init(void *vprsactx, void *vrsa, in rsa_verify_recover_init() argument
1014 static int rsa_verify_init(void *vprsactx, void *vrsa, in rsa_verify_init() argument
1228 void *vrsa, const OSSL_PARAM params[]) in rsa_digest_sign_init() argument
1232 return rsa_digest_signverify_init(vprsactx, mdname, vrsa, in rsa_digest_sign_init()
1276 return rsa_digest_signverify_init(vprsactx, mdname, vrsa, in rsa_digest_verify_init()
[all …]
/openssl/providers/implementations/asymciphers/
H A Drsa_enc.c96 static int rsa_init(void *vprsactx, void *vrsa, const OSSL_PARAM params[], in rsa_init() argument
102 if (!ossl_prov_is_running() || prsactx == NULL || vrsa == NULL) in rsa_init()
105 if (!ossl_rsa_key_op_get_protect(vrsa, operation, &protect)) in rsa_init()
107 if (!RSA_up_ref(vrsa)) in rsa_init()
110 prsactx->rsa = vrsa; in rsa_init()
136 static int rsa_encrypt_init(void *vprsactx, void *vrsa, in rsa_encrypt_init() argument
139 return rsa_init(vprsactx, vrsa, params, EVP_PKEY_OP_ENCRYPT, in rsa_encrypt_init()
143 static int rsa_decrypt_init(void *vprsactx, void *vrsa, in rsa_decrypt_init() argument
146 return rsa_init(vprsactx, vrsa, params, EVP_PKEY_OP_DECRYPT, in rsa_decrypt_init()

Completed in 15 milliseconds